IL-1β及其受体在机械性脑损伤大鼠大脑皮质及海马中的表达  被引量:4

Expression of IL-1β and its receptor in parietal cortex and hippocampus of rats with traumatic brain injury

摘  要:目的通过复制Marmarou大鼠机械性脑损伤模型,研究脑损伤后白细胞介素1β(interlukin-1β,IL-1β)及其受体IL-1RI在大脑皮质和海马中表达的时序性特点及二者之间的相互关系。方法将60只清洁级雄性SD大鼠随机分为正常对照组、手术对照组及损伤后1 h组、2 h组、4 h组、8 h组1、2 h组2、4 h组2、d组3、d组5、d组。采用组织芯片及免疫组化技术检测大脑皮质和海马中IL-1βI、L-1RI的表达情况。结果对照组大脑皮质、海马部位均表达少量IL-1β及IL-1RI。与对照组相比,损伤组皮质和海马中IL-1β的表达在损伤后30 min^12 h组显著升高(P<0.01),并在2 h达高峰,然后逐渐降低,损伤后24 h降至正常水平,而皮质和海马中IL-1RI的表达在损伤后1~12 h组显著升高(P<0.01),并在4 h达高峰,然后逐渐降低,损伤后72 h降至正常水平。结论IL-1β及IL-1RI的表达在闭合性脑损伤早期即显著升高,后期逐渐恢复正常,两者在损伤后表达的时序性变化特点基本一致,共同参与脑损伤的病理生理过程。Objective To stodytheexpression of interleukin-1β(IL-1β)anditsreceptor Ⅰ(IL-1RI)in Marmarou's rat medels ,and the relationship hetwcen their expressions and the temporal patterns following injury. Methods Sixty male Sprague - Dawley rats were randomly divided into normal control, sham operated control and injured groups. The injury group were then subdivided into 30 rain, 1 h, 2 h, 4 h, 8 h, 12 h, 24 h, 48 h, 72 h and 5 d subgroups according to the time elapsed after injury. The expressions of IL- 1β and IL- IRI in parietal cortex and hippocampus were studied by tissue chip array and immunohistchemistry. Results Scanty expressions of IL- 1β and IL- IRI were observed in control groups. From 30 min to 12 h after brain injury, the number of IL- 1β positive cells increased progressively in parietal cortex and hippocampus ( P 〈0.01, compared with control group), and the peak level appeared at 2 h ( P 〈0.01, compared with control group) .24 h after brain injury, he number of IL- 1β positive cells decreased progressively to the normal.From 1 h to 12 h after brain injury, the number of IL- IRI positive cells increased progressively in parietal cortex and hippocampus ( P 〈 0.01, compared with control group), and the peak level appeared at 4 h ( P 〈0.01, compared with control group) .72 h after brain injury,the number of IL- IRI positive cells decreased progressively to the normal. Conclusions Both IL- 1β and IL- IRI are highly expressed early after brain injury and have similar temporal patterns. The expressions of IL- 1β and its receptor IL- IRI play an important role in the progression of brain injury.
